What is the Space for Youth project?

The municipality of West Maas en Waal wants to give young people space, both literally and figuratively. Space to grow up in a responsible, healthy, and safe way. We believe it is important to involve young people in society. Youth participation is therefore an important part of this. We want young people to be able to participate in society in a positive way, tailored as much as possible to their needs.

Origin Space for Youth

The Space for Youth project originated from the 2022-2026 coalition agreement.

The mission stated in the coalition agreement includes:

  • Developing a comprehensive youth policy focused on prevention, raising awareness of substance use, and encouraging activity and positive positioning. Specifically, preventing substance use and undesirable activities.
  • “Creating dedicated meeting places for young people, equipped with Wi-Fi hotspots, for example. Working with young people, parents, schools, and youth workers to find a sustainable solution to these needs and then implementing it in a way that minimizes any potential nuisance.”

We are implementing this with the Space for Youth project.

In addition, in 2024, the municipality of West Maas en Waal adopted a new policy framework for the social domain. The title of the policy framework is'Building a strong social foundation'. One of the programs in this framework is 'Growing up with opportunities'. In this program, we focus on the healthy development of young people and the development of their talents. The Ruimte voor de Jeugd (Room for Youth) project falls under this program and has been set up to take the first steps in that direction.

Working method Space for Youth

The Space for Youth project is based on the Growing Up in a Promising Environment program . This is a program run by the Trimbos Institute. The program uses a scientifically proven effective approach. This is the approach of the Icelandic Prevention Model.

The components of the Space for Youth project

The Icelandic prevention model focuses on four areas that influence young people's behavior. These are:

  1. Family
  2. Peer group (friends and peers)
  3. School
  4. Leisure time

Each component includes protective and risk factors. The Room for Youth project utilizes components from the Icelandic prevention model.

But we have added an extra component: feeling good about yourself. This is because the aim of the project is also to promote mental well-being among young people.

The phases of the Space for Youth project

The project consists of four phases. These are:

  1. Monitoring;
  2. Feedback and dialogue;
  3. Policy-making;
  4. Implementation

Community building is central to these four phases. This means that we bring parents and local partners together around the young people. In this way, we build a network around them.

Results Space for Youth

The Space for Youth project was launched in 2023. Three phases of the project were completed in 2023: monitoring, feedback, and policy-making. We are now in phase 4: implementation.

The project has revealed that there is a need for meeting places for young people. This is a priority for young people, parents, and professionals. Based on the information from the project, the municipal executive decided in January to create two youth meeting places. One in Beneden-Leeuwen and one in Dreumel.
